STOCKTON, Calif – After an extended break the Tigers are ready to get back in action with a trip this week to take on the top team in the WCC, #18 BYU. This will be the third time this season the Tigers have faced a ranked team after playing Oregon State and Stanford earlier in the year.

THE YOUTH MOVEMENT:
The freshman class continues to be as good as advertised, with
Anaya James leading the team in scoring at 15.5 points per game and
Elizabeth Elliott being second on the team with 12.7 points per game.
Anaya James has been named the WCC Freshman of the Week four times and is leading the conference in weekly awards.
Elizabeth Elliott also has won the award once this season as well.
RETURNING TIGERS:
Sam Ashby has come alive as of late, setting a career high in points against UNLV with 31. Ashby is leading the team in three-point shooting percentage and is second in shooting percentage.
Madelene Ennis is leading the team in rebounding and is shooting 50% from the floor for the season.
RANKS IN THE WCC:
Sam Ashby leads the WCC in three-point shooting percentage and is the only player in the WCC to be shooting over 50% from three.
Anaya James is fifth in the WCC in scoring and leads all freshman in scoring. James is third in steals per game and fifth in assists per game.
Elizabeth Elliott is second in the WCC in points per 40 minutes.
HISTORY BETWEEN THE TWO:
The two teams most recently played in February of 2021, with BYU winning 65-52. The Tigers have not defeated the Cougars since January 2018.
